    We are planning to go back for our 10 year anniversary in Aug 2011. My ? is how soon is too soon to plan and booking a trip. I want to make sure that we have everything booked and ready to go as I have a busy household and I don't want to miss anything.

    Hi Shannon!

    I think I might be a bit biased on this answer!! I'm a plan-a-holic AND Disney is my favorite place! Not sure I can think of any reasons NOT to book for 2011!

    Here are my thoughts on this: Planning in advance helps to make sure that you have the best shot at getting the hotels, restaurants and events you'd like to experience. For guests willing to plan ahead, you have a great advantage in timing. By booking in advance, you'll be able to begin making your Advance Dining Reservations and event reservations 180 days in advance. Hopefully, this will help you scoop up the coveted dining spots and times!

    Usually, when you are an early planner, you'll be able to have your choice of resorts and room categories. And, if for some reason you can't get your first choice- you have plenty of time to call back and keep checking.

    In fact, the only disadvantage I can think of to booking early doesn't even apply for your trip! Usually special offers are announced only a few months in advance, so you don't know if you'll be able to save some money on your trip. BUT, just this week, Disney announced some great deals for 2011! You can check these out now AND take advantage of them early (in case they sell-out!!).

    So, go for it! I don't see any downside to booking early and it will feel great to have one less thing to do later!
